Join the Manta Queen 7 liveaboard as she sets sail for 4 nights of fantastic diving in the Similan Islands and delivers excellent service and comfort on board. With 10 cabins onboard catering to a maximum of 24 guests, the Manta Queen 7 offers a comfortable trip to the Similan Islands. Each cabin has air conditioning and bathroom facilities are shared. For relaxation, guests can laze around on the large sun deck in between dives or hop on the tender and head over to one of the beautiful white-sand beaches of the Similan Islands. The saloon has an HD TV to watch movies, and all meals are freshly cooked and served buffet-style in the open-air dining area.
The experienced and professional dive crew of the Manta Queen 7 will help you to explore world-famous dive spots at Koh Bon, Koh Tachai, Koh Surin, Richelieu Rock, and Boon Sung Wreck. Dive with Whale Sharks at Richelieu Rock, Manta Rays of Koh Tachai, and exciting swim-throughs of the well-known Elephant Head Rock.

Included: VAT, Airport Transfer, Hotel Transfer, Drinking Water, Soft drinks, Tea & Coffee, Full-Board Meal Plan (All meals), Snacks, Diving Package, Snorkel Gear, Cabin Towels, Complimentary Toiletries, WiFi internet.
Required Extras: National Park Fees (1,300-2,500 THB per trip).
Optional Extras: Dive Insurance (800-1,300 THB per trip), Gratuities, Nitrox (2,500-3,500 THB), Nitrox Course (8,000 THB), Private Dive Guide (3,500 THB per day), Rental Gear, Scuba Diving Courses (2,000-8,000 THB).
